Cloverbud: Trees and Me
Join us as we learn about nature and trees and how to identify them as we have fun learning through hands on activities.
This fun and interactive 4-H program invites youth ages 5–7 to explore the wonders of nature by discovering trees all around them. Through hands-on activities, children will learn how to identify different types of trees by their leaves, bark, and shapes. They’ll also discover how trees provide homes for animals like birds, squirrels, and insects, helping them understand the important role trees play in our environment. With games, crafts, and outdoor exploration, young learners will build curiosity and appreciation for the natural world.
